Image-guided surgery for thoracic ossification of the posterior longitudinal ligament. Technical note.

Abstract

The authors describe an anterior decompression procedure for thoracic ossification of the posterior longitudinal ligament (PLL) in which they used an image guidance system in three cases. To make registration possible in anterior thoracic surgery, they devised a surgical reference frame that could be connected to a rod and attached to an external fixation device, which was then attached to the thoracic VB. The mean fiducial error at the registration was acceptable (range 0.5-0.8 mm). They were able to confirm the success of decompression on postoperative computerized tomography scans. In the removal of an ossified thoracic PLL, an image guidance system has been shown to be a useful tool.
